#b29eac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b29eac is composed of 69.8% red, 62%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.2% magenta, 3.4%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 318 degrees, a saturation of 11.5% and a lightness of 65.9%. #b29eac color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#653d59.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#b29eac color description : Dark grayish pink.
#b29eac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b29eac has RGB values of R:178, G:158,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.03,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11706028.
